"Should I take Liam Ottley's AI Agency Course?" - Breakdown
Someone asked if they should take Liam Otley's AI agency course alongside technical voice agent courses. This is actually a critical fork in the road that will determine your entire AI career path. Here's the framework I use:
First, you need to decide which side of the AI business you want to be on: Are you building an AI agency (managing people who implement solutions) or are you the technical expert building voice agents? These require completely different skill sets.
The biggest trap I see: Technical people think their expertise naturally translates to running a business. It doesn't. This "E-Myth" kills more businesses than anything else. Running operations requires a completely different mental framework.
If you're building an AI agency: Focus on Liam's course entirely. You need high-level operational thinking. The technical details matter less than your ability to lead, sell, and build systems. Hire specialists for the technical work.
If you're becoming a voice agent specialist: Go deep on the technical courses. Master the craft. Then either join an agency as their expert or freelance your skills to businesses directly. One specialized skill can be more profitable than surface knowledge of many.
The real mistake is trying to be both at once. Being the technician AND the CEO rarely works. Pick your lane, master it completely, then consider expanding. Half-attention to both paths usually means success in neither.
